Businessman Ibrahim Mahama has donated bags of rice to chiefs and residents of Damang as part of preparations for the upcoming mine handover ceremony scheduled for April 18.
The gesture is seen as a show of goodwill and support to the local community ahead of the historic transition. The donation is expected to support families and traditional leaders as they prepare for the anticipated celebration.
Residents have welcomed the move, describing it as timely and thoughtful, especially as the community gears up for a significant moment in its mining history.
The handover marks a new phase for Damang, with expectations high among locals regarding development, employment opportunities, and improved living conditions.
